在当今这个信息爆炸的时代,网站已经成为企业、个人展示形象、传播信息的首选平台。而DedeCMS作为一款功能强大、操作简便的网站内容管理系统,深受广大用户的喜爱。其中,DedeCMS模板是网站建设的灵魂所在,它决定了网站的整体风格和用户体验。本文将为大家详细讲解DedeCMS模板的相关知识,助你打造个性化网站。
一、DedeCMS模板概述
1. 什么是DedeCMS模板?
DedeCMS模板是指由HTML、CSS、JavaScript等前端技术编写的文件,它负责展示网站的内容和样式。通过修改模板文件,可以改变网站的整体风格和布局。
2. DedeCMS模板的作用
(1)提升网站视觉效果:精美的模板可以提升网站的视觉效果,吸引更多用户关注。
(2)优化用户体验:合理的布局和设计可以提高用户体验,让用户更愿意浏览和浏览网站。
(3)降低开发成本:使用DedeCMS模板可以缩短开发周期,降低开发成本。
二、DedeCMS模板类型
1. 系统模板:DedeCMS自带的一套模板,包括默认模板、行业模板等。
2. 自定义模板:用户根据自身需求,自行设计的模板。
3. 第三方模板:由第三方开发者制作的模板,风格多样,功能丰富。
三、DedeCMS模板制作
1. 模板制作工具
(1)Dreamweaver:一款功能强大的网页制作软件,支持多种前端技术。
(2)Sublime Text:一款轻量级的文本编辑器,支持多种编程语言。
(3)Visual Studio Code:一款免费的代码编辑器,支持多种编程语言。
2. 模板制作步骤
(1)分析需求:明确网站的主题、风格、功能等需求。
(2)设计布局:根据需求设计网站的整体布局。
(3)编写代码:使用HTML、CSS、JavaScript等前端技术编写模板代码。
(4)测试与优化:测试模板的兼容性、性能,并进行优化。
四、DedeCMS模板应用
1. 上传模板
(1)登录DedeCMS后台。
(2)点击“系统”菜单,选择“模板管理”。
(3)点击“上传模板”按钮,选择本地模板文件,上传并安装。
2. 应用模板
(1)登录DedeCMS后台。
(2)点击“系统”菜单,选择“全局变量”。
(3)在“模板目录”选项中,选择所需的模板。
(4)点击“保存”按钮,应用模板。
五、DedeCMS模板常见问题及解决方法
1. 模板兼容性问题
(1)原因:浏览器版本、浏览器内核等差异导致。
(2)解决方法:使用兼容性较好的前端技术,如HTML5、CSS3等。
2. 模板加载缓慢
(1)原因:模板文件过大、图片过多等。
(2)解决方法:优化模板代码,减少图片数量,压缩图片等。
3. 模板功能缺失
(1)原因:模板功能未实现或实现不完善。
(2)解决方法:自行修改模板代码,或寻求第三方模板支持。
DedeCMS模板是网站建设的灵魂所在,通过合理的设计和制作,可以打造出个性化、美观、实用的网站。希望本文能为大家在DedeCMS模板制作和应用方面提供一些帮助。祝大家在网站建设中取得成功!
以下是一个表格,总结了DedeCMS模板制作和应用的关键步骤:
| 步骤 | 操作 | 说明 |
|---|---|---|
| 1 | 分析需求 | 明确网站主题、风格、功能等 |
| 2 | 设计布局 | 设计网站整体布局 |
| 3 | 编写代码 | 使用HTML、CSS、JavaScript等编写模板代码 |
| 4 | 测试与优化 | 测试模板兼容性、性能,并进行优化 |
| 5 | 上传模板 | 在DedeCMS后台上传模板文件 |
| 6 | 应用模板 | 在DedeCMS后台选择模板并应用 |
注意:以上内容仅供参考,具体操作请以实际情况为准。
dedecms模板标签手册:[2]channel|案例详解
标签名称:channel
标记简介:织梦常用标记,通常用于网站顶部以获取站点栏目信息,方便网站会员分类浏览整站信息
功能说明:用于获取栏目列表适用范围:全局使用
typeid参数 typeid='栏目ID'此参数调用指定栏目下的子类{dede:channel typeid='4'} a href='[field:typelink/]'[field:typename/]/a{/dede:channel}
type参数 type='son| sun' son表示下级栏目,self表示同级栏目,top顶级栏目{dede:channel type='top'} a href='[field:typelink/]'[field:typename/]/a{/dede:channel} type参数与模板的环境有关,比如,当浏览“新闻“这个栏目时,那么son就表示“新闻“栏目的子类当栏目下没子类时,type="son"和type="self"调取的数据是一样的,都是当前分类本身。但是在顶级分类中,type="self"获取的将是空数据。首页无法使用type="son"和type="self"
组合查询下面这个模板语句不管在任何页面,调取的都是栏目id为4的同级栏目。{dede:channel typeid='4' type="self" row="1"} a href='[field:typelink/]'[field:typename/]/a{/dede:channel}
其他参数 currentstyle=''应用样式{dede:channel type='son' currentstyle="lia href='~typelink~' class='thisclass'~typename~/a/li"} lia href='[field:typeurl/]'[field:typename/]/a/li{/dede:channel} row='100'调用栏目数




